Nokia claims to have sold 5 million + N-Series mobile phones
The world’s largest handset maker Nokia has said that they have sold more than 5 million units of their recently launched N-Series range of mobile phones around the world.
The company also launched three new models on Tuesday as they aim to expand in the luxury phone market. Anssi Vanjoki, the head of Nokia’s multimedia unit added that they are expecting the multimedia phone market to grow to 100 million units in 2006.
Nokia further believes that the market would grow to as many as 250 million units in the next 2 years. This gives them a huge potential to tap this segment of the market with these new N-Series phones.
Nokia N93: This new model from Nokia is a video camera model, which comes with optical zoom.
Nokia N73: This phone from the company comes with a 3 megapixel Carl Zeiss lens.
Nokia N72: This is primarily a music capable phone and is expected to be available in the retail market by this coming June.
